Auburn, NE is a relatively safe community in comparison to the national average. The violent crime rate in Auburn is 8.1, which is significantly lower than the US average of 22.7. Likewise, the property crime rate in Auburn stands at 28.8, again significantly lower than the US average of 35.4. This means that overall, Auburn has much lower crime rates than those found across the country on average, making it a safe and desirable place to live.
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
